corosync?corosync的由来是源于一个Openais的项目,是Openais的一个子 项目,可以实现HA心跳信息传输的功能,是众多实现HA集群软件中之一,heartbeat与corosync是流行的Messaging Layer (集群信息层)工具。而c...
分类:
数据库 时间:
2015-11-09 00:20:02
阅读次数:
286
扩容主/备物理数据盘:[root@MySQL02~]#drbdadmdowndata[root@MySQL02~]#mount/dev/sdb1/mnt/[root@MySQL02~]#df-hFilesystemSizeUsedAvailUse%Mountedon/dev/sda37.2G1.9G5.0G28%/tmpfs242M0242M0%/dev/shm/dev/sda1194M57M128M31%/boot/dev/sdb1380M11M350M3%/mnt#可以看到备..
分类:
其他好文 时间:
2015-11-03 23:04:49
阅读次数:
232
主备模式DRBD1:eth0:10.0.0.3eth1:172.16.1.3用于心跳线和数据同步(在工作中,一般把心跳线分开)VIP:10.0.0.103DRBD2:eth0:10.0.0.4eth1:172.16.1.4用于心跳线和数据同步(在工作中,一般把心跳线分开)VIP:10.0.0.104其中eth1是直接相连的。是heartbeat直接的心跳线[roo..
分类:
其他好文 时间:
2015-11-03 17:58:42
阅读次数:
372
dbrd可以实现数据的同步,drbd一般是一主一从,所有的读写操作,挂载只能在主节点上进行。drbd主从节点可以调换。通过corosync+pacemaker实现drbd主从点挂掉后能自动切换到从节点上,实现故障转移继续提供服务。因此可以将mysql的数据放置到drbd数据块上。drbd:DRBD:(distribu..
分类:
数据库 时间:
2015-10-31 01:47:24
阅读次数:
285
Distributed Replicated Block Device(DRBD)是一个用软件实现的、无共享的、服务器之间镜像块设备内容的存储复制解决方案。其核心功能通过Linux的内核实现,比文件系统更加靠近操作系统内核及IO栈。DRBD是由内核模块和相关脚本而构成,用以构建高可用性的集群。其实现方式是通过网络来镜像整个设备。你可以把它看作是一种网络RAID。它允许用户在远程机器上建立一个本地块设...
分类:
其他好文 时间:
2015-10-30 14:20:54
阅读次数:
185
1、drbd工作模型:primary/secondaryprimary:可挂载、可读写secondary:不可挂载primary/primary必要条件:HA环境,使用ClusterFS(集群文件系统)2、pacemaker+drbd:primary/secondary:将drbd定义成master/slave类型的资源:能自动完成primary/secondary角色切换,还能够通过在..
分类:
其他好文 时间:
2015-10-29 18:28:25
阅读次数:
215
一. ? ? 环境描述 OS环境:CentOS 5.5 x86_64 (development环境) DRBD版本: drbd83-8.3.13-2.el5.centos.x86_64 kmod-drbd83-8.3.13-1.el5.centos.x86_64 MySQL版本:MySQL 5.5.28 Keepalived版本:keepali...
分类:
数据库 时间:
2015-10-27 15:36:14
阅读次数:
288
测试环境:OS:rhel6.5node1:192.168.1.121corosyncpacemakermysqlddrbdcrmshpcsnode2:192.168.1.122corosyncpacemakermysqlddrbdVIP:192.168.1.160软件版本:corosync-1.4.7-2.el6.x86_64.rpmpacemaker-1.1.12-8.el6.x86_64.rpmpcs-0.9.90-1.el6_4.noarch.rpmpython-pssh-2..
分类:
数据库 时间:
2015-10-26 18:51:48
阅读次数:
351
1.方案简介本方案采用Heartbeat双机热备软件来保证数据库的高稳定性和连续性,数据的一致性由DRBD这个工具来保证。默认情况下只有一台mysql在工作,当主mysql服务器出现问题后,系统将自动切换到备机上继续提供服务,当主数据库修复完毕,又将服务切回继续由主mysql提供服务。2..
分类:
数据库 时间:
2015-10-23 18:59:03
阅读次数:
347
关于MySQL-HA,目前有很多种解决方案,目前互联网上用的较多的是Keepalived+Mysql Replication组合、MMM+Mysql Replication组合、Heartbeat+DRBD+Mysql组合,以及红帽RHSC高可用集群套件。
分类:
数据库 时间:
2015-10-23 18:23:43
阅读次数:
281